Assessing Communication Skills
Reviewing interaction abilities is vital when picking a criminal defense lawyer. You'll desire a person who not just talks clearly but additionally pays attention properly. Your lawyer should make you really feel understood and ensure that you grasp every facet of your situation.
Seek a legal representative who can discuss complicated legal terms in straightforward language. They should be friendly, making it very easy for you to ask questions and reveal worries. Notice how they connect throughout your first examination. Are they patient? Do they give in-depth answers or thrill via explanations?
Excellent communication likewise implies staying in contact. Your lawyer must upgrade you routinely concerning your case's progress. Examine if they prefer e-mails, telephone call, or face-to-face meetings and see if their recommended technique aligns with your requirements.
Last but not least, consider their ability to interact under pressure. Court room setups are high-stress settings, and you require somebody that can articulate your defense plainly and well before a judge and jury.
Request instances of just how they have actually handled difficult cases or scenarios in the past.
Understanding Defense Methods
Understanding the numerous protection techniques your attorney could utilize is vital to successfully navigating your case. Each method hinges on the specifics of the fees you're dealing with and the proof versus you. Let's delve into what you need to understand.
First of all, if there's an absence of proof, your legal representative may suggest that the prosecution hasn't fulfilled its burden of proof. Bear in mind, it's not your task to show innocence; it's the district attorney's work to verify regret past a sensible question. If they can't, you must be acquitted.
One more usual technique is self-defense, particularly in cases including costs like assault or homicide. If you were safeguarding on your own, your attorney might use this approach to warrant your activities legitimately. This requires showing that your perception of danger was reasonable which your feedback was proportional to that danger.
Occasionally, your defense could involve doubting the validity of exactly how evidence was gotten. If police breached your legal rights throughout the examination, proof could be reduced, which can significantly damage the prosecution's instance.
Ultimately, your lawyer could negotiate a plea deal if it serves your benefit. This typically happens if the evidence against you is solid but there are mitigating variables that can result in reduced costs or sentencing.
Recognizing these methods aids you discuss your case better with your lawyer.
